Russell Brand did not disappoint his fans. They had turned out in their hundreds to see the comedian despite the allegations of serious sexual misconduct levelled against him, strenuously denied by the comedian, and their solidarity was rewarded by his defiance.
“Support for Russell” was the theme of the night, during a set in which the most political and anti-authoritarian perforations earned the biggest applause. The messages of support apparently stem from the belief that Brand’s large following on social media and anti-establishment opinions are of concern to those in power. There was no sign of protest outside, and inside, those attending the show were always confident it would go ahead, without any intervention by either Brand or the venue.Queues for the stall selling Brand merchandise were briefly as long as those for the bar and the hot-dog stand: fans could purchase Brand-branded t-shirts, mugs, water bottles and notepads marked with the word “Community” and his frequently used crow symbols.
